What is Delegated Credentialing?

March 19, 2025 / Alex J. Lau / Credentialing, Delegated Credentialing, Delegation Agreement
Credentialing specialist reviewing provider applications

Delegated credentialing is an arrangement in which a health plan formally authorizes a healthcare organization (such as a hospital, physician group, or integrated delivery network) to perform the credentialing process on the health plan’s behalf. Instead of each insurance company independently verifying a provider’s credentials, the health plan accepts the organization’s credentialing decisions, provided the […]

The Future of Provider Credentialing: Trends and Predictions

February 27, 2025 / Alex J. Lau / Medical Credentialing
Future of Provider Credentialing, Trends and Predictions

Provider credentialing is changing faster in 2025 and 2026 than it has in the previous two decades. The core process, verifying a provider’s education, licensure, board certifications, malpractice history, and work record, remains the same. What is changing is how that verification is performed, how long it takes, and how many times the same provider […]
